Output 3ec559ae4aa895f0ea8a18b4d9bbbcce968abc3fa6181e7f4b49e25ca0aa9d91:0

value
565966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93972cc6f3301505df1b702cfac2d1d8fcfbbbc5 OP_EQUAL
address
3F9QMZRK3gah8KCbUQnDfgGWi5ib5u2pcr
transaction
3ec559ae4aa895f0ea8a18b4d9bbbcce968abc3fa6181e7f4b49e25ca0aa9d91
confirmations
290565
spent
true